The Erosion of Personal Privacy and Data Exploitation

The most immediate and alarming threat posed by widespread AR adoption is the unprecedented assault on personal privacy. Unlike a smartphone that we glance at periodically, AR devices, particularly smart glasses, are designed to be worn constantly. They are always-on, always-watching, always-listening portals. These devices require a suite of sensors—high-resolution cameras, microphones, depth sensors, inertial measurement units (IMUs), and eye-tracking technology—to function. This creates a perpetual data collection apparatus strapped to a user's face.

The data harvested is not merely browsing history or location points; it is profoundly intimate and contextual. It is a record of everything you look at, for how long, and how your pupils dilate in response. It captures your unconscious glances, your living room layout, the expressions on your children's faces, and your confidential documents left on a desk. This continuous environmental and biometric data stream creates a digital twin of your life with a fidelity never before possible. The threat lies in how this data is stored, analyzed, and potentially sold or stolen. This information could be used for hyper-targeted advertising so manipulative it feels like thought control, for insurance premium adjustments based on your diet and activity, or for employer surveillance that monitors attention and productivity in terrifying detail.

The concept of informed consent becomes meaningless in this always-on environment. While a user might consent to an app using their camera for a specific task, the device itself is fundamentally built for persistent, ambient data collection, creating a panopticon where users are constantly monitored and the very notion of a private moment evaporates.

Physical Safety and Security in an Overlaid World

AR inherently distracts users from their physical surroundings by directing their attention to digital artifacts. This introduces grave risks to personal safety. A pedestrian engrossed in an AR game or information overlay may fail to notice an approaching vehicle, a step on the curb, or another person. The threat extends beyond individual clumsiness to broader public safety concerns. Malicious actors could create AR applications or hijack existing ones to deliberately create hazardous situations.

Imagine navigation arrows that guide a user into oncoming traffic, or safety warnings that obscure real-world dangers. Furthermore, the technology could be weaponized for sophisticated phishing attacks, known as "perceptual hacking." A hacker could overlay a fake login portal onto a real public terminal, tricking users into entering their credentials. Or they could create a virtual interface over a real ATM, skimming card information and PINs in a way that is invisible to the naked eye but perfectly clear through the AR lens. The physical world becomes a canvas for digital deception, eroding trust in our own senses and environment.

Psychological and Cognitive Consequences

The long-term psychological impact of living with an augmented perception of reality is perhaps the most complex and worrying threat. AR has the potential to profoundly alter human cognition, social interaction, and mental well-being.

  • Reality Blurring and Depreciation: When the digital and physical are seamlessly merged, the line between what is real and what is virtual becomes dangerously thin. This could lead to a phenomenon where the un-augmented physical world feels barren, boring, or insufficient. Users might develop a preference for their digitally enhanced reality, leading to a depreciation of genuine human experience and the natural world.
  • Behavioral Manipulation: With eye-tracking and biometric data, AR platforms can perform A/B testing on your perception in real-time. They can determine which visual overlay, color, or message most effectively captures your attention and influences your behavior. This isn't just advertising; it's a powerful tool for shaping opinions, voting patterns, and consumer habits on a subconscious level, posing a fundamental threat to autonomy and free will.
  • Social Isolation and Anxiety: While AR promises enhanced social connectivity through avatars and shared virtual spaces, it could further erode face-to-face interaction. Why engage with the imperfect person in front of you when you can interact with a curated, idealized digital projection of them? This could exacerbate social anxiety and lead to new forms of isolation, where individuals are physically present but mentally and emotionally elsewhere.

The Weaponization of Perception and Societal Control

On a macro scale, AR presents a terrifying tool for misinformation and societal control. The technology allows for the alteration of perceived reality at a mass level. A government or malicious entity could deploy AR filters that erase dissident graffiti from walls, change the text on protest signs, or overlay propaganda onto public spaces. Historical monuments could be digitally altered to reflect a skewed version of history. In conflict zones, AR could be used to mislead troops or civilians, creating phantom enemies or hiding real threats.

This creates a world where there is no longer a shared, objective reality. Two people standing in the same location could be seeing entirely different things based on the software they are running or the filters applied by their network provider. This "reality divide" threatens to shatter any remaining common ground needed for civil discourse, democratic processes, and social cohesion, making it the ultimate tool for sowing discord and enforcing control.

Legal and Ethical Gray Zones

The law is notoriously slow to adapt to technological change, and AR will create a labyrinth of unprecedented legal and ethical dilemmas. Who is liable when an AR distraction causes a car accident—the driver, the app developer, or the device manufacturer? How do we define trespassing or harassment when someone projects a virtual object into your private property visible only through a device? Intellectual property rights become murky when digital assets can be permanently anchored to physical locations. The potential for AR-based defamation, virtual vandalism, and new forms of cyberbullying that feel intensely real and present is vast and largely unlegislated.

Mitigating the Onslaught: A Path Forward

Confronting these threats is not a call to abandon AR technology, but a imperative to develop it responsibly. Mitigation must be a multi-faceted effort involving developers, regulators, and users alike.

Privacy by Design: AR hardware and software must be built with privacy as a core principle, not an afterthought. This includes implementing robust on-device data processing, giving users clear and granular control over their data, and developing transparent data policies that are easy to understand.

Strong Regulatory Frameworks: Governments need to enact legislation that specifically addresses AR data collection, biometric privacy, and digital content liability. These laws must be flexible enough to adapt to rapid technological advances while firmly protecting fundamental human rights.

Digital Literacy and Critical Thinking: As users, we must cultivate a new form of media literacy—reality literacy. Education should focus on teaching individuals to critically evaluate digital content overlaid on their world, to understand the persuasive intentions behind AR experiences, and to maintain a healthy skepticism about the interfaces they are shown.

Ethical Development Charters: The tech industry should collaboratively establish and adhere to strong ethical guidelines for AR development, prioritizing user well-being over engagement metrics and data monetization.
